How much do remote engineering administrator j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ote engineering administrator in the United States is $29.53,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.67 and $32.45 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Engineering Administ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Engineering Administrator, you need strong organizational skills, knowledge of engineering processes, and experience with project coordination, typically supported by a degree in engineering, business administration, or a related field. Familiarity with project management software (such as Asana or Jira), document management systems, and communication tools like Slack or Microsoft Teams is essential.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ving skills help you effectively collaborate with distributed teams and manage multiple priorities. These skills and qualities are crucial for maintaining seamless project workflows, ensuring timely deliverables, and supporting remote engineering teams efficiently.

What is a Remote Engineering Administrator?

A Remote Engineering Administrator is a professional responsible for managing and coordinating administrative tasks for engineering teams, often while working from a remote location. Their duties typically include handling documentation, supporting project management, scheduling meetings, maintaining records, and ensuring smooth communication among team members. They may also assist with budgeting, resource allocation, and compliance with company policies. This role is essential in supporting engineers so they can focus on technical work, and it requires strong organizational and communication skills. Working remotely, these administrators use digital tools to stay connected and efficient.
